  • Store-front clinic

    Usually, a small health services program located in a neighborhood for the ready access of residents.  

  • Storage fat

    Excessive reserves of body fat. Storage fat is the extra fat that accumulates in fat (adipose) cells around internal organs and beneath the skin surface to insulate, pad, and protect the body from trauma and extreme cold.   • Stop-start technique

    Treatment for premature ejaculation in which stimulation is ceased just prior to ejaculation, then resumed once the urge to ejaculate dissipates, squeeze technique.  

  • Stomach medicine

    A slang expression for drugs used or intended for gastrointestinal disturbances, e.g., antacids.

  • Stimulus/response bit

    A conceptual unit consisting of sensory input to a person and the response that input produces.  

  • Stimulus generalization

    A similar reaction to a variety of stimuli.  

  • Stimulation theory

    The theory that reinforcement is a matter of stimulation.  

  • Stimulation

    Increase in the rate of functional activity, speeding up of the central nervous system function. The action of stimulating something. The irritating or arousing of muscles, nerves, or other sensory organs. Irritating or invigorating action of agents on muscles, nerves, or sensory end organs by which excitation or activity in a part is evoked.
